Ibidpur Population - Barddhaman, West Bengal
Ibidpur is a medium size village located in Raina - I Block of Barddhaman district, West Bengal with total 221 families residing. The Ibidpur village has population of 923 of which 462 are males while 461 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Ibidpur village population of children with age 0-6 is 120 which makes up 13.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Ibidpur village is 998 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Ibidpur as per census is 1222, higher than West Bengal average of 956.
Ibidpur village has higher liter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Ibidpur village was 81.57 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Ibidpur Male literacy stands at 86.52 % while female literacy rate was 76.46 %.

Ibidpur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 221 | - | - |
Population | 923 | 462 | 461 |
Child (0-6) | 120 | 54 | 66 |
Schedule Caste | 263 | 124 | 139 |
Schedule Tribe | 1 | 0 | 1 |
Literacy | 81.57 % | 86.52 % | 76.46 % |
Total Workers | 316 | 287 | 29 |
Main Worker | 103 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 213 | 201 | 12 |
